It is undoubtedly one of the soap operas of the summer. After a remarkable season with Newcastle (27 goals in 42 matches), the Swedish striker was targeted by many English clubs this summer. Starting at the Clash with Newcastle, the 25-year-old attacker was taken in flu by his supporters and with the arrival of Nick Woltemade in St-James Park, a departure from Isak was inevitable.
Finally, the situation decanted on the last day of this transfer window. Indeed, pushed towards the exit, Isak was approached by Liverpool, who came many times to the information in recent months, and the operation was formalized this Monday against a check for 150 million euros. A mirific figure that makes Isak the biggest transfer in the history of the Premier League.
